New Features
The Performance Wizard Version 4.2 product offers several new enhancements:
H
Support for Hotwire M/HDSL and M/SDSL devices:
— Hotwire 7974, 7975, and 7976 Multirate Symmetric Digital Subscriber
Line (M/SDSL) Standalone Units
— Hotwire 7984, 7985, and 7986 Multirate High-bit-rate Digital Subscriber
Line (M/HDSL) Standalone Units
— Hotwire 8774, 8775, and 8776 M/SDSL Cards
— Hotwire 8784 and 8786 M/HDSL Cards
H
Support for FrameSaver Service Level Verifier (SLV) devices:
— FrameSaver SLV 9124-A2 T1 Access Unit
— NextEDGE
t
9192/9195 Multiservices Access System
— FrameSaver SLV 9580 T3 ATM DSU
H
Automated installation of the Apache Web server
H
Additional features for FrameSaver Service Level Management (SLM)
Reports:
— Option to export report raw data
— Ability to request exception filtering of report data
— Report Scheduling feature
H
Diagnostic Wizard GUI provides windows to view status, run tests, and
diagnose FrameSaver network problems.
H
Navigation Wizard collects additional device parameters, including:
— Device Name
— Device Serial Number
H
New Device dialog provides a history list display.
H
Edit Connection dialog provides both the local and remote connection
information.
